The Best Firefox Add-Ons For Internet Marketers [Video]

Firefox is regarded as the best Web browser in terms of extensions - i.e. small browser add-ons which modify or add to existing functionality. It has hundreds of add-ons, which can be downloaded from here

Here’s the list…

Google Global - Google Global is an unobtrusive Firefox extension that allows you to see what the Google search results that you are viewing look like from different geographical locations.

ScribeFire - ScribeFire is a full-featured blog editor that integrates with your browser and lets you easily post to your blog.

Update Scanner - Monitors web pages for updates. Useful for websites that don’t provide Atom or RSS feeds.

CoLT - CoLT makes it easy to copy either a hyperlink’s text or both the link and the link’s text (in a format you specify). Two handy context-menu items make this possible, and don’t add clutter; the items are only visible when right-clicking a link!

Window Resizer - Allows you to resize your browser to common resolution sizes allowing you to view website designs in a variety of popular browsing dimensions.

MeasureIt - Allows you to overlay a ruler on a browser page so you can verify width, height and alignment of page elements.

DownThemAll! - Download one link or multiples, has a built-in accelerator.

Screengrab! - Saves the entire web page as an image.

Download Helper- Will extract content (read:videos) from many different sites (read:youtube)

Firefox Companion for eBay - Keep an eye on your eBay trading wherever you are on the web when you install the eBay Companion for Firefox.

Dummy Lipsum - Generate “Lorem Ipsum” dummy text (from http://www.lipsum.com).

ColorZilla - Advanced Eyedropper, ColorPicker, Page Zoomer and other colorful goodies.

Fast Video Download - Download video files from popular sites like YouTube, Dailymotion, Break.com and more.

Tab Scope - Preview and navigate tab contents through popup.

Shareaholic - Shareaholic allows you to share, bookmark, and e-mail web pages quickly via a wide array of web 2.0 social websites without cluttering up your browser!

Session Manager - Session Manager saves and restores the state of all windows - either when you want it or automatically at startup and after crashes. Additionally it offers you to reopen (accidentally) closed windows and tabs.

If I could add to what you already listed from a web designers perspective, I’d list: Web Developer - which gives you a toolbar with various developer tools; SEopen - which gives you some great SEO tools like page rank, back links checker, etc; Search Status - which displays the Google PageRank, Alexa rank and Compete ranking of any page; Niche Watch Tool - which gives you backlinks number, indexed pages, keyword occurences on a page; Alexa Sparky - which puts Alexa data in your statusbar; and last but not least Piclens - just because it makes looking through photos cool!
